Cutting-edge Zoning Laws for Urban Growth
Land use regulations have long been the backbone of metropolitan design, regulating how land can be allocated and where distinct categories of development can happen. In recent years, creative approaches to zoning have been gaining traction as cities strive to address rapid urban population growth. These revised laws aim to be more adaptable, allowing mixed-use developments that integrate residential, business, and community spaces, thus cultivating thriving communities. By reexamining traditional zoning regulations, urban planners can create environments that not only boost livability but also promote environmentally conscious growth.
Another major trend in zoning innovation is the push for incentives for density and affordable housing initiatives. Cities are recognizing the value of inclusivity in urban design and are adopting policies that incentivize developers to add affordable units in their projects. These steps seek to tackle the increasing housing costs that accompany urbanization, ensuring that multifaceted populations can thrive together within the same neighborhoods. By updating zoning laws to prioritize affordable housing, cities can help preserve social equity while still bolstering economic development.
Additionally, embedding smart city concepts into zoning regulations is reshaping urban landscapes. Planners are increasingly leveraging data-driven insights to guide zoning decisions, optimizing land use based on real-time analytics and community needs. This incorporation of technology enables responsiveness in urban design, addressing issues like transportation bottlenecks and infrastructure maintenance more successfully. Forward-thinking zoning laws that incorporate smart city principles allow for tailored responses to evolving urban challenges, leading to adaptable and responsive cities.
Smart Cities: Utilizing Tech in Metropolitan Spaces
The growth of smart cities represents a notable transition in metropolitan infrastructure, where technology is woven into the fabric of city living. By utilizing advanced data analytics, IoT devices, and real-time monitoring, urban planners can make educated decisions that boost the quality of life for residents. This combination aids in improving services such as congestion control, waste collection, and energy usage, creating a more productive urban environment. As metropolitan populations grow, these technologies help manage resources efficiently, addressing the issues that come with rising demand.
One of the critical components of smart cities is the deployment of intelligent transportation systems. These systems leverage data from devices and user behaviors to optimize road maintenance and traffic flow, decreasing congestion and enhancing safety. For instance, smart traffic signals modify to immediate conditions, facilitating smoother traffic patterns and minimizing wait times. This not only helps daily commuters but also supports emergency services by facilitating quicker response times, ultimately protecting lives in critical situations.
Additionally, zoning laws play a pivotal role in shaping how technology is integrated within city spaces. As municipalities adjust their rules to embrace new technologies, they create opportunities for groundbreaking infrastructure projects that align with community needs. This includes technology-driven parking solutions, urban agriculture initiatives, and renewable energy installations that enhance sustainability. By cultivating an environment where technology can prosper, cities can progress into more integrated and resilient ecosystems that cater to the demands of their increasing populations.
Green Road Upkeep for Upcoming Cities
As urban communities continue to expand, the requirement for optimized and sustainable road upkeep has never been more essential. Traditional maintenance practices often rely on antiquated techniques that can be both expensive and ecologically damaging adverse. Cities must adopt innovative approaches that prioritize the longevity of infrastructure while minimizing negative impacts on the surrounding ecosystem. This shift not only enhances road quality but also contributes positively to the overall green initiatives goals of intelligent cities.
One successful approach is the use of advanced materials and technologies in road construction and fixes. Incorporating repurposed materials into surface material and using drainage-friendly paving can improve the longevity of streets while lessening excess materials.
